Shoal Publications

 

Menu

Tools > Report > Publication

The Publication tool can be used to generate a shoal report once shoals have been detected. This report is saved as a PDF file, and contains information about a single superselected shoal, such as:

Location coordinates

Size

Depth

Reference feature

Clearance

Depth of associated template

The report may also provide an image of the single shoal as it was displayed in the Display window at the time the New Publication dialog box was opened. Any maps/data visible in the Display window at the time will also be included in this image.

To publish a shoal, you must first have a shoal layer open, and a shoal box superselected. If you do not have a shoal box selected, the fields in the publication will not be populated with data. For more information on detecting shoals or opening an existing shoal map see Detect Shoals.

Once a shoal publication has been created, the resulting PDF can be associated with the shoal. This populates the Publication (shlpub) attribute of the shoal box with the name and location of the PDF. The publication can then be viewed directly from the application by pressing the <Ctrl> key and clicking on the attribute value.

Procedure

1. In the Layers window, select the Shoals layer.

2. Superselect the shoal box for which you want to publish a report.

3. Adjust the view in the Display window to ensure that the shoal and any other relevant data is displayed as you want it to appear in the report.

4. Select the Publication command.

The New Publication dialog box is displayed. Refer to Publication for information on this tool.

5. Select a shoal template file for the publication. A default shoal publication template, shoal_publication_template.rpx, is provided with the application. This file is located at:

C:\ProgramData\CARIS\<application>\<version>\SampleData\

6. If necessary, adjust the settings for any of the Publication objects.

7. Click Publish.

An Export dialog box is displayed to define the name and location for the PDF file.

8. Navigate to the output location and specify a name for the file, then click Save.

The PDF Export Settings dialog box is displayed.

9. Adjust the image quality setting, if needed, and click OK.

The publication is generated and stored as a PDF file in the specified location. The Associate Shoal to Publication dialog box is displayed.

10. To associate the publication with the shoal and record this in the shoal database, click OK. Otherwise, click Cancel.

The shoal publication will be associated with the shoal box. If the shoal has not been registered in the database, a message will be displayed stating that the association could not be recorded in the database.
